nginx執(zhí)行shell腳本 如何用linux命令查看nginx是否在正常運行?
如何用linux命令查看nginx是否在正常運行?每一個運行的Linux應(yīng)用程序都會產(chǎn)生一個進程,所以我們可以通過檢查nginx進程是否存在來判斷它是否啟動。1. 有時,如果您想知道nigix是否正常
如何用linux命令查看nginx是否在正常運行?
每一個運行的Linux應(yīng)用程序都會產(chǎn)生一個進程,所以我們可以通過檢查nginx進程是否存在來判斷它是否啟動。
1. 有時,如果您想知道nigix是否正常運行,需要使用Linux命令檢查nginx的操作。執(zhí)行命令:PS-a | grep nginx。如果返回結(jié)果,則表示nginx正在運行,服務(wù)已經(jīng)啟動。如果你不怕nginx關(guān)閉的話。您還可以執(zhí)行:Service nginx restart。當(dāng)nginx服務(wù)重新啟動時,您還可以查看是否有任何特定的錯誤。
2. 查看端口netstat-ntlp;查看進程PS-EF | grep nginx;查看日志是否更新tail-F訪問.log.
3. 直接查看進程ID:PS-cnginx-opid。這種直接返回PID的方法更適合與其他程序結(jié)合使用,比如在shell/Python腳本中執(zhí)行這個命令得到PID,然后根據(jù)PID判斷nginx是否啟動。建議使用此方法。